Heidegger and the Politics of Poetry Tom McHugh Kim Tolley lays out theThis volume collects and translates Philippe Lacoue Labarthe's studies of Heidegger, written and revised between 1990 and 2002. All deal with Heidegger's relation to politics, specifically through Heidegger's interpretations of the poetry of Hlderlin.
